Output 577d4bea328b310ebdef8f9e86ef08cdaa1f80fe0208ca3e5fe31c85a56e1895:1

value
632500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b367a46f5edb7d970f6d778f83322ab67eef5b03 OP_EQUAL
address
3J3d35P4wmFmjTkSPBJpEgutEf1hXbYDov
transaction
577d4bea328b310ebdef8f9e86ef08cdaa1f80fe0208ca3e5fe31c85a56e1895
spent
true